Krysten Ritter pens first novel

Krysten Ritter may have been busy with "Jessica Jones" but the actress also found time to write her first novel.
The star has penned a psychological thriller named "Bonfire," about an environmental lawyer tackling company officials accused of dumping toxic waste, reported Entertainment Weekly.
"As a huge fan of psychological suspense novels, I was so thrilled to take on the challenge of writing my first book," said Ritter in a statement.

"This was an exciting opportunity for me to explore a character journey and really get inside the head of my protagonist, a process that has a lot in common with how I prepare to play a role."
The novel will be published by Crown Archetype, and is scheduled for release on November 7.
Ritter isn't the first actress to turn author - Julianne Moore and Julie Andrews both have their own collections of children's books, while Lauren Graham and Gillian Anderson have also found success writing novels.
